I landed this Hot Rod shop t-shirt gig cause they wanted toons and a printer sent'em to me so I'm pleased. It's gonna be one of those really busy shop designs so I get to have some fun with people, tools, animals, and cars. They wanted a 51 chevy with stacks and a Metro (which is always fun), and the other car was up to me. They had me at the shop a couple of times and I got pics of all the staff and all the cars in the shop. (very cool...just like Boyd except not as big or as neat or as....nevermind) in any case it was really cool.

I know you all already know this so I'll just show some sketches.

It's all real rough but I know there's somethin in there somewhere. I'm going to use these to put together a rough comp for concept and me and the customer can flesh it out together.

I went after the 51 one more time as it is the main vehicle. I'll probably flip this so I can put the shop manager in it and make it kinda like a combo between the 2 I have.

I wanted to come in sorta like George Trosley but me (he's been a great friend since I was in art school)...you know...pay a little tribute...nibble but not bite.

Everything will be hand inked. Probably microns on paper. I might use a flair like Troz and I did toy with doing it all brush but I didn't want to have to make them giant to get detail (I'm a fat brusher...not brother....brusher).
